"GRAPHIC NOVELS. GRAPHIC NOVEL. Blind acrobat Daredevil was inspired to heroism by the example of his prizefighter father. But Matt Murdock is a young man in love with Karen Page. Then, Peter Parker and Gwen Stacy want to spend the rest of their lives together. But first, Spider-Man must run a gauntlet of his greatest foes. And no matter how powerful the incredible Hulk becomes, his heart can still be shattered by Betty Ross. The daughter of his greatest enemy! Collecting: Daredevil: Yellow 1-6, Spider-Man: Blue 1-6, Hulk: Gray 1-6."
